Bridging: Use a ref to bridge_channel's channel to prevent crash.

There's a race condition with bridging where a bridge can be torn down
causing the bridge_channel's ast_channel to become NULL when it's still
needed. This particular case happened with attended transfers, but the
crash occurred when trying to publish a stasis message. Now, the
bridge_channel is locked, a ref to the ast_channel is obtained, and that
ref is passed down the chain.

/*!
* \brief Get a ref to the bridge_channel's ast_channel
*
* \param bridge_channel The bridge channel
*
* \note The returned channel NEEDS to be unref'd once you are done with it. In general, this
* function is best used when accessing the bridge_channel chan from outside of a bridging
* thread.
*
* \retval ref'd ast_channel on success
* \retval NULL otherwise
*/
struct ast_channel *ast_bridge_channel_get_chan(struct ast_bridge_channel *bridge_channel);

struct ast_channel *ast_bridge_channel_get_chan(struct ast_bridge_channel *bridge_channel)
{
struct ast_channel *chan;
ao2_lock(bridge_channel);
chan = ao2_bump(bridge_channel->chan);
ao2_unlock(bridge_channel);
return chan;
}
